Presentation
Left leg pain.
Patient Data
A lucent lesion with a sclerotic rim located eccentrically in the distal metaphysis of tibia. A narrow zone of transition is seen. No associated periosteal reaction, cortical breach or associated soft tissue mass.
A cortical-based distal tibial medial aspect metaphyseal lesion is noted with low signal intensity on T1WI, high signal intensity on STIR with a thin hypointense rim on both sequences. No surrounding edema. There is heterogeneous post-contrast enhancement. It measures about 3.3 cm in length.
Rest of the imaged bones are normal
Case Discussion
The features are very likely of Non-ossifying fibromas (NOF); a larger version of fibrous cortical defect.
